"HARWASTING"

REVALORIZATION OF HARVESTED AGROFOREST BIOMASS WASTE AS FEEDSTOCKS FOR ADD-VALUED BIO-BASED SOLUTIONS FOR A GREEN DEVELOPMENT




DESCRIPTION

HarWASTing aims to develop innovative business models based on circular economy (CE) principles to promote bioeconomy in rural areas, by implementing a set of scalable and replicable technological solutions to efficiently exploit underutilized biomass from forestry and agriculture to develop innovative and high-value products. These models will support sustainable management practices and will promote an efficient use of natural resources, reducing overall waste generation and post-harvest losses by implementing valorization processes and fostering CE principles.
To this end, a methodology will be implemented to collect, treat and revalorize biomass from forest and agricultural harvest, pruning waste and bioethanol process side-streams, respecting the cascade principle for biomass use. A one-fits-all technology, Hydrothermal Carbonization, for a higher energy efficient treatment of lignocellulosic biomass residues will be combined with Pressurized Hot Water Extraction and innovative post-treatment technologies, to develop high-value added products and avoid any non-valorized side-stream. The whole concept will be demonstrated at small-scale pilot, built-upon existing wood, food and bioenergy value chains to further strengthen their economic and environmental sustainability through synergistic interlinkages between them. Mediterranean, Boreal and Continental bioregions will be studied.
The holistic concept is based on the central valorization route of HTC and its solid product, hydrochar, that is converted into hybrid wood-hydrochar panels with less than 10% of bio-adhesive for special applications such as fire protection or electromagnetic shielding. A novel support AI-based digital tool for forecasting agroforest feedstock availability will be developed. Innovative digital passports will help to commercialize the panels and bioadhesives. The hydrochar will be offered on a new digital platform which also serves for networking and for publishing of best-practices.

OBJECTIVES

HarWASTing proposes to turn LCB from diverse feedstocks into a biomass commodity product consisting of refined hydrochar through chemical and physical dehydration. Biomass producers or owners will be engaged by a new BMs for the biomass processing plant. In addition, a new value cycle will transform refined hydrochar into a carbon sink as hybrid wood panels, using bio-adhesives based on activated lignin or tannin obtained other side streams such as bark and fermentation residues to make them 100% fossil free. Leverage will be achieved through the implementation of a Digital Product Passport, a digital tool to qualify and quantify potentially available biomass using remote sensing data and artificial intelligence (AI) for accurate forecasting, a collaborative digital platform and multiple mini-stimuli supported by Cascade Funding.

To achieve this objective, 5 specific objectives (SOs) have been defined and related with corresponding outputs (OUT), exploitable results (ER) and work packages (WP) where they will be addressed mainly.

SO1. To develop two new BMs, build-upon existing EU food, feed and bioenergy value chains from 2 different EU deprived and depopulated rural regions located in 2 EU bioregions (Boreal and Mediterranean), with an active role of primary producers.
SO1.1: To improve innovation capacities and product portfolio extension in primary production sectors by diversifying and enhancing incomes derived from current rejected/burnt agroforest waste.

SO2. To scale up and demonstrate in small-scale bio-based pilots, technical, environmental and economic feasibility along the studied value cycles of several biomass waste treatment technologies and high-value solutions using underutilized and side streams agroforest biomass as feedstock
SO2.1: Sustainable, zero-waste extraction of tannins to be used in 100% biobased adhesives.
SO2.2: Lignin with improved reactivity and 100% renewable bio-adhesives with >75% lignin content.
SO2.3: To implement a value cycle involving HTC/post-treatment, producing hybrid panels (wood-hydrochar) for special applications in the construction sector in a technical and economic manner.
SO2.4: Revalorized liquid fraction from HTC process as fertilizer (rich in K) and irrigation water.

SO3. To improve the knowledge on the quantitative and qualitative requirements of feedstock, harvesting or logistics and process parameters of pre-treatment, treatment and post-treatment processes
SO3.1: Digital Product Passport for innovative products developed including biogenic carbon.

SO4. To facilitate the knowledge of available biomass feedstock from agriculture and forestry.
SO4.1: A cloud-based digital tool to qualify and quantify potential availability of biomass waste from agriculture and forestry, using remote sensing data and artificial intelligence (AI) for accurate prediction.

SO5. Closely interact with other projects under this topic and create a joint stakeholder platform to promote best-practice use cases for primary producers & SMEs, promoting policy guidelines for CAP & MMEE.
SO5.1: A collaborative digital platform for knowledge exchange and marketplace for LCB and hydrochar.
